Like he said, being able to queue stuff up remotely and push it to the console while you're away so you don't have to go through the whole redeem/download/install thing really is a time saver (especially with the PS3, which doesn't really have file size limits and thus can take a really long time to pull down and install when you just want to play the game). It's something that is supported on not just the 360, but on stuff like Android devices (dunno if that's the case for iOS stuff too as I don't own any), but it's increasingly something that goes beyond simple convenience to becoming really, really useful. It's a feature that you don't realize how much you miss until you don't have it.

KimchiHead posted:I heard red dead redemption is vastly superior on the PS3 than XBOX 350. It's so much better, it may as well be an exculsive. I'd get that. Not to YCS but no. PS3 only has 1 exclusive hideout for sam which sucks and is useless. You do however get a nice reduced resolution @ 640p, like GTA4, instead of 720. Bugs are about on par and draw distance is the same, with less LOD and less grass on screen. Nothing that really changes gameplay, only cosmetic changes but with ROCKSTAR being the wisenheims they decided there will be no RDR on pc, so as it stands, 360 only has a slight edge in visuals, nothing more. On a personal opinions the ps3 controls sucked, but I was really holding out for a PC release so I might see some mods, like GTA4.
